进销存系统与微信订货系统数据同步方案
在传统商贸企业的数字化转型中,进销存系统与微信订货系统的数据割裂是常见痛点。宁夏昱皓软件技术有限公司推出的货口袋APP,通过底层API实时对接,将采购管理、库存管理与移动订货系统的订单流打通,实现“下单即同步、出库即更新”。这种方案不仅减少了人工录入误差,更让经销商管理效率提升约40%。
核心同步机制与关键参数
数据同步的核心在于**双端字段映射规则**。以货口袋APP为例,微信订货系统产生的订单,会通过中间件实时写入进销存系统的订单管理模块。具体同步逻辑分为三步:
1. 订货端(如加盟商订货)创建订单时,自动触发库存预占;
2. 进销存系统根据库存可用量进行审核,若缺货则通过销售管理模块生成采购建议;
3. 审核通过后,订单状态回传至微信订货系统,且库存量实时扣减。同步延迟通常控制在3秒以内,即使遇到网络波动,系统也会启动离线队列重试机制,确保数据最终一致。
值得注意的是,**库存管理**的同步颗粒度需要精细到“仓位级别”。例如,某食品企业同时管理常温库和冷链库,货口袋APP的移动订货系统会要求经销商在订货时选择指定仓库。若进销存系统未启用多仓位核算,同步后可能导致出库地址错误。我们建议在实施前,先梳理库存维度与订货系统的SKU编码规则是否一致。
实施中的常见问题与对策
- 数据冲突:当经销商通过微信订货系统下单时,若后台进销存恰好正在执行盘点,可能出现库存预占失败。解决方法是设置“盘点期间锁定订货渠道”,或在订单系统中启用预占库存缓冲池。
- 订单状态漂移:部分企业的订单系统与进销存的“已发货”状态定义不同步。例如,物流单号生成即视为发货,但仓库实际未出库。我们要求客户在实施时统一状态机——货口袋APP的订单管理模块强制使用“出库扫码确认”作为最终状态。
- 历史数据迁移:老系统迁移时,未完结订单的同步需逐笔校验。曾有客户因未处理“跨期订单”的税率字段,导致财务对账出现0.2%的偏差。建议采用分批次迁移+自动对账脚本预处理。
方案落地的技术选型建议
对于年订单量超过10万笔的企业,推荐采用**异步消息队列+ESB企业服务总线**的架构。宁夏昱皓软件技术有限公司在实施某连锁品牌的网上订货系统时,曾遇到高峰时段(如促销活动)每秒并发请求超过200笔,通过将进销存的采购管理模块与订单系统解耦,利用Redis缓存预占库存,最终将同步成功率稳定在99.97%。如果企业预算有限,也可以采用轻量级方案——直接基于货口袋APP的开放API做定时批量同步,但需注意避免在整点触发脚本导致数据库锁死。
真正的价值在于,当销售管理、库存管理、经销商管理在同一个数据闭环中运转时,企业可以实时看到每个SKU的动销率。某饮料代理商反馈,使用这套方案后,加盟商订货的周转天数从7天缩短至2.8天,而滞销品的识别周期提前了11天。这不仅仅是工具升级,更是经营逻辑的转变。